Performers at the Ranch Rodeo

Performers at the Ranch Rodeo

Back in November I had the opportunity to photograph a Ranch Rodeo at Grizzle Ridge Arena. It was my first time seeing a Ranch Rodeo that kicked off with performances from drill teams, mounted shooters, trick riders, and some crowd participation events like stick horse barrel racing.

Winter Sort: November 10th

Winter Sort: November 10th

Taking on the challenge that is sorting I was back out at a Grizzle for their November sort. Sorting is a challenge to photograph not because of the number of bodies in the pen but because of the size of the pen which limits the option for what lenses can easily be used.
